NTC Thermistor Applications: Uses in Automotive, HVAC & Electronics

NTC thermistors are widely used across industries due to their high sensitivity, fast response, and cost-effective temperature measurement. From automotive systems to medical devices, NTC thermistors play a critical role in ensuring safety, performance, and reliability.

In this article, we explore the most common NTC thermistor applications and explain how different industries use them.


1. Automotive Applications

NTC thermistors are extensively used in automotive electronics for temperature monitoring and control, including:

  • Battery temperature monitoring (EV & energy storage)

  • Engine coolant and oil temperature sensing

  • Cabin climate control systems

  • Motor and inverter protection

Their fast response and stability make NTC thermistors ideal for harsh automotive environments.

2. HVAC & Home Appliances

In HVAC systems and household appliances, NTC thermistors help maintain comfort and energy efficiency.

Typical applications include:

  • Air conditioner temperature control

  • Heat pumps and thermostats

  • Refrigerators and freezers

  • Water heaters and boilers

Customized resistance values and housings allow NTC thermistors to fit different system designs.


3. Consumer Electronics

Compact size and accuracy make NTC thermistors suitable for consumer electronics such as:

  • Smartphones and laptops

  • Battery packs and chargers

  • Power adapters

  • Wearable devices

They help protect batteries from overheating and improve overall product reliability.

4. Medical & Industrial Equipment

NTC thermistors are also used in medical and industrial fields where accurate temperature control is critical:

  • Medical diagnostic equipment

  • Patient monitoring devices

  • Industrial power supplies

  • Automation and control systems

High reliability and consistent performance are essential in these applications.


Choosing the Right NTC Thermistor for Your Application

When selecting an NTC thermistor, key factors include:

  • Operating temperature range

  • Resistance value and tolerance

  • Packaging and installation method

  • Environmental conditions
